WHAT IS A TECHNICAL OFFICIAL?

As in most sporting competitions, basketball employs officials in order to control the flow of the game and

enforce the rules.

Referees

Table officials/Scorer

Referee and Second Referee

1. Inspect the equipment.

2. In-charge of jump ball and warm up.

3. During the game, determine the calls, violations, fouls, and misconduct.

Table Officials

1. Record of line up.

2. Record the score.

3. Accomplish the score sheet.

4. Determine the possession of the ball.

5. Signal if there is time out and substitution.

Table Officials

6. Keep track of the statistic of the players

7. In-charge of time keeping.

What is the difference between Foul and Violation?

Are they important? Why?

Violations occurs when the player breaks one of the rules of Basketball. A violation results in the awarding of the ball to the opponents.

Foul is an illegal action that can be committed by player from one team against a player from the opposing team.
